Q: Is 127,164,649 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 127,164,649 is a composite number.

Why is 127,164,649 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 127,164,649 can be evenly divided by 1 53 2,399,333 and 127,164,649, with no remainder.

Since 127,164,649 cannot be divided by just 1 and 127,164,649, it is a composite number.
